Riyo Chuchi was a female Pantoran senator who served as a politician during the final years of the Galactic Republic.

Early Life

Problems with a protectorate

Born in 38 BBY, Riyo was raised by her father and mother who served as senators during the Separatist Crisis. She also had a younger brother named Kirin Chuchi who was born on 28 BBY. After her parents were assassinated, the two were raised by Chairman Chi Cho. Chi decided to teach Riyo how to become an idealist of the Republic while her brother remained with the foster family. Riyo promised that she would visit her brother while she attended to work for the Republic. After the Separatist Crisis ended on 22 BBY, Riyo was appointed as senator of the Galactic Senate when the Clone Wars began.

Death

In 20 BBY, Riyo was selected by Senator Amidala to join her in a secret meeting on Naboo. She was seen with her aide while boarding a cruiser with several senators and bureaucrats. She was perished in the explosion which killed everyone onboard. The assassin responsible for the assassination, was revealed to be Herbin, who was working with the Confederacy of Independent Systems, made a deal with Nute Gunray to assassinate Amidala.

Legacy

After her death, Chi Eekway Papanoida replaced her as senator and continued her business during the Clone Wars.

Personality and traits

Riyo Chuchi was a firm believer in the use of diplomacy. When she first became a senator, she had a timid personality and submitted completely to Chairman Cho's more dominating air. By the time of the Blockade of Pantora she had become a stronger individual, and was able to successfully blackmail a Trade Federation envoy into lifting the blockade. Chuchi was also good friends with Ahsoka Tano.
